A Gigabyte is a unit of digital information storage, equating to approximately one billion bytes, or precisely 10^9 bytes. Commonly used to quantify data storage and transfer capacities, gigabytes are integral in defining storage limits for devices like smartphones, computers, and external drives. In practical terms, a gigabyte can hold around 1,000 megabytes or roughly 1,024 megabytes when using binary calculations. This unit helps users understand and manage the space required for files, applications, and system functions, making it an essential measure in the digital world.
Definition of ExabitAn Exabit is a substantial unit of digital information used primarily in data transfer measurement, amounting to 10^18 bits. It encapsulates an enormous amount of data, reflecting the growing scale of global internet traffic and large-scale data storage solutions. Exabits are useful in contexts where massive data throughput is discussed, such as in telecommunications and data centers. Understanding and utilizing Exabits is crucial for businesses and technologies dealing with big data analytics, cloud computing, and large-scale digital communication networks.
